Senior Ground Software Engineer II/ Principal Ground Software Engineer

Rocket Lab is an end-to-end space company delivering responsive launch services and spacecraft design. The Senior Ground Software Engineer II/ Principal Ground Software Engineer will serve as a technical authority for spacecraft ground software, focusing on defining and evolving the architecture of ground systems for mission success.

Responsibilities

Own major parts of architecture and evolve Rocket Lab’s web-based ground software platforms for spacecraft operations
Partner with flight software developers, mission operations personnel, and systems engineers to translate mission needs into scalable ground system designs
Deploy, configure, and optimize the Rocket Lab Ground Data System for diverse mission profiles
Establish robust monitoring, alerting, and reliability frameworks to proactively detect and mitigate issues
Provide technical direction and architectural guidance to ensure mission resilience, system integration, and long-term maintainability
Serve as a trusted advisor to leadership on ground software strategy, risk areas, and emerging technologies
